<p>I just built a combined FE/BE from:<br>
Zotac ionitx l-e <br>
4gb ram<br>
Apex mi-008 case<br>
Mobil rack for two 2.5" drives(3.5" bay)<br>
2.5" 120gb sata <br>
2.5" 500gb sata<br>
PicoPSU 80 Watt power supply<br>
HDHR dual tuner<br>
Hauppauge HVR 1950<br>
kaze jyu slim 100mm case fan</p>
<p>I cannot hear it sitting next to it.</p>
<p>I can watch a recording while recording 4 digital and one analog show using about 40% CPU. Commercial flagging uses about 80% of one CPU.</p>
<p>Mother board has wireless but I have never used it</p>
